What to Know About USPS in Sailor Springs, Illinois

Sailor Springs is a small village located in Clay County, Illinois, with a population of approximately 100 residents. This low population density can often facilitate quicker deliveries compared to more congested urban areas, as there is typically less traffic and fewer logistical complications for carriers. The village is situated within a rural setting, which generally means fewer obstacles such as high-rise buildings or heavy commercial traffic that can delay delivery times. The local USPS office operates with a commitment to ensure that all residents receive their mail and packages promptly, utilizing the village's well-maintained road infrastructure to navigate effectively within the county.

The geographic landscape of Sailor Springs features a primarily flat terrain, typical of the Midwest, allowing for easier access for USPS delivery vehicles. The region experiences a temperate climate with four distinct seasons, which may sometimes impact delivery schedules, especially during winter months when snow and icy conditions can arise. However, USPS is well-equipped to handle seasonal challenges and has a robust system in place to ensure that deliveries occur as scheduled whenever possible. Overall, residents of Sailor Springs can expect reliable postal service with attention to the unique factors associated with their rural environment.
